Beginning of a Busy Weekend

Randy & I went to Pickers this morning, as usual, but there is a twist. We met at Anchors Aweigh Campground to begin our annual dulcimer festival. Folks will come from all over the area to camp and play music for the next three days.

Tomorrow there will be jam sessions throughout the day, with a potluck supper capping off the festivities.

Saturday is the big day. In the morning folks will again be jamming, but the afternoon is what everyone looks forward to. That's when Open Stage takes place. Clubs, groups, and individuals will take the stage to showcase their talents. It's a great time with great music and fun. In the evening, our club will provide a dinner of red beans and rice.

Sunday morning we'll host a devotion/hymn sing. This portion of the festival is less heavily attended, unfortunately. Randy & I have found we really enjoy it and wish more folks would come. But, no matter, we enjoy it and it's a nice way to end the festival.
